Liette is a girl’s name of French origin, meaning “A French diminutive of 'Lise' or 'Lisette,' which are themselves diminutives of Elizabeth, meaning 'pledged to God'.”, and peaked in popularity in 2006.

The Story of Liette
A delicate French whisper, carrying a pledge of devotion with an air of refined grace.
Liette is a French diminutive, a tender shortening of names like Lise or Lisette, which themselves stem from Elizabeth. This lineage means 'pledged to God,' offering a sophisticated European charm rooted in classic devotion.
